Background
After radical hysterectomy, when lymph is cleaned, a control nerve of a bladder in a pelvic cavity can be damaged, during the period, a urinary catheter is always worn, but the urinary system of a patient is infected to a certain extent after the urinary catheter is worn for a long time. Some patients may have urinary tract infection or even bladder infection for a long time, and the bladder function is not easy to recover, and the patients can normally have a contraction like the bladder through intermittent autonomous catheterization. However, the patient cannot urinate, and the patient needs to manually assist in urination. When the patient urinates intermittently, the patient needs to insert the urinary catheter in a semi-recumbent position, and some auxiliary articles are needed to assist in inserting the urinary catheter, so that the self-catheterization chair is provided.

Referring to fig. 1-7, this embodiment provides an autonomous urethral catheterization chair, which includes a seat support 1, a folding leg 2, a folding backrest 3 and a folding leg support 4, wherein a limiting steel plate 101 is fixed on one end of the seat support 1, the limiting steel plate 101 is provided with a plurality of limiting bayonets, the seat support 1 is provided with an upward inclined support plate, the seat support 1 and the support plate are provided with limiting chutes 102, the seat support 1 is further fixed with a seat cushion 103, the upper end of the folding leg 2 is disposed in the bayonets of the limiting steel plate 101 through bolts, the lower end of the folding backrest 3 is disposed on the limiting chutes 102 of the seat support 1 through locking screws, one end of the folding leg support 4 is disposed on one end of the seat support 1 through locking screws, and the two sides of the seat support 1 are respectively provided with a first armrest 5 and a second armrest 6, in this embodiment, the seat support 1 and the folding leg, Folding back 3 and folding leg hold in the palm and be swing joint between 4, when not needing the use, can fold up, reduce the volume of whole catheterization chair, reduce the space occupancy of catheterization chair in the ward, the convenience in use has been improved, folding landing leg 2 plays the effect of supporting whole catheterization chair, folding back 3 can adjust the back angle according to patient's needs, make patient reach a comparatively suitable posture, be convenient for urinate, folding leg holds in the palm 4 can conveniently support patient's shank, when crooked shank, also can support the sole, first handrail 5 and second handrail 6 can play auxiliary function when patient uses.
The folding leg 2 comprises a first leg frame 201 and a second leg frame 203, a first reinforcing rod 202 is fixed between the first leg frame 201, the upper end of the first leg frame 201 is hinged to the bottom of the seat support 1, a second reinforcing rod 204 is fixed between the second leg frame 203, the upper end of the second leg frame 203 is embedded into a bayonet of the limiting steel plate 101 through a bolt, the first leg frame 201 and the second leg frame 203 are rotatably connected through a connecting rod 205, in the embodiment, the first leg frame 201 and the second leg frame 203 can be folded and unfolded through the connecting rod 205, the first reinforcing rod 202 reinforces the first leg frame 201, the second reinforcing rod 204 reinforces the second leg frame 203, and the upper end of the second leg frame 203 can be adjusted on the bayonet of the limiting steel plate 101, so that the unfolding degree of the whole folding leg 2 can be conveniently adjusted.
The folding backrest 3 comprises a backrest frame 301 and an adjusting rod 304, the lower end of the backrest frame 301 is slidably arranged in the limit sliding groove 102 through a locking screw, a back cushion 302 is fixed on one side of the backrest frame 301, a carrying rod 303 is also fixed on the backrest frame 301, one end of the adjusting rod 304 is rotatably arranged on the carrying rod 303, a fixing rod 305 is fixed on the other end of the adjusting rod 304, a plurality of bayonets are arranged on the adjusting rod 304, and the bayonets on the adjusting rod 304 are clamped on the bearing rod 104, in this embodiment, the locking screw drives the backrest frame 301 to slide in the limiting sliding slot 102, so as to facilitate folding the backrest frame 301, and when the backrest frame 301 is adjusted to a proper angle, the backrest frame 301 is fixed through a locking screw rod, the adjusting rod 304 can rotate by taking the bearing rod 303 as the center of a circle, when the angle of the backrest framework 301 is adjusted, bayonets with different heights on the carrying rod 304 can be selected to be clamped on the bearing rod 104 according to the adjusted angle.
Folding leg holds in palm 4 and includes leg support 401, and leg support 401's one end is fixed in the one end of seat support 1 through locking screw, is fixed with leg pad 402 on leg support 401, and in this embodiment, locking screw can fix when leg support 401 suitable angle, conveniently supports patient's shank, when crooked shank, also can support the sole.
The first armrest 5 comprises a first vertical plate 501, a first upright column 502 and a supporting plate 508, one end of the first vertical plate 501 is fixed on the seat support 1, the other end of the first vertical plate 501 is provided with a notch 505, a placing groove 504 is arranged in the notch 505, a sliding rail 506 is arranged on the side wall of the notch 505, one end of the first upright column 502 is fixed on the seat support 1, the other end of the first upright column 502 is fixed on the first vertical plate 501, a measuring cup support 503 is fixed on the first upright column 502, a first main rubber pad 507 is fixed at the top end of the first vertical plate 501, one end of the supporting plate 508 is fixed with a sliding block 509, the other end of the supporting plate 508 is fixed with a convex block 510, a first auxiliary rubber pad 511 is fixed on the convex block 510, the supporting plate 508 is placed in the placing groove 504, the sliding block 509 is located in the sliding rail 506, in the embodiment, the measuring cup support 503 is used for placing a measuring cup for receiving urine, the supporting plate 508 is used as a test bench for placing a test article, and can be drawn, the sliding block 509 props against the top end of the sliding rail 506, the supporting plate 508 is flatly placed by rotating the sliding block 509, and when a test article is not required to be placed, the supporting plate 508 can be retracted into the first vertical plate 501, so that the normal use of the first handrail 5 is not influenced.
The second handrail 6 comprises a second vertical plate 601 and a second upright post 602, one end of the second vertical plate 601 is fixed on the seat support 1, the other end of the second vertical plate 601 is fixed with a second main rubber cushion 613, one end of the second upright post 602 is fixed on the seat support 1, the other end of the second upright post 602 is fixed on the second vertical plate 601, the second upright post 602 is provided with a first slip ring 603 and a second slip ring 606 in a sliding manner, the first slip ring 603 is positioned right above the second slip ring 606, the first slip ring 603 is fixed with a first soft rod 604, the front end of the first soft rod 604 is fixed with a spotlight 605, the second slip ring 606 is fixed with a second soft rod 607, the front end of the second soft rod 607 is fixed with a magnifying glass 608, the outer side wall of the second vertical plate 601 is provided with a placing cavity 609, the side wall of the placing cavity 609 is provided with a first side groove 610 and a second side groove 611, the first side groove 610 is flush with the first soft rod 604, the second side groove 611 is flush with the second soft rod, place to articulate on the chamber 609 and have chamber door 612, in this embodiment, but first sliding ring 603 and second sliding ring 606 free rotation on second stand 602, place chamber 609 and be used for accomodating spotlight 605 and magnifying glass 608, when needs use, open chamber door 612, rotate first sliding ring 603, first sliding ring 603 drives spotlight 605 of first soft pole 604 front end and rotates suitable position, be used for assisting the magnifying glass, help the patient independently insert the catheter, rotate second sliding ring 606, second sliding ring 606 drives the magnifying glass of second soft pole 607 front end and rotates suitable position, when the patient is semi-recumbent, oneself inserts the private part of oneself with the catheter through the magnifying glass.
